Prevalence of visual impairment due to refractive error among children and adolescents in Ethiopia: A systematic review and meta-analysis.

Abstract

INTRODUCTION

Globally, the prevalence of refractive error was 12%, and visual impairment due to refractive error was 2.1%. In sub-Saharan Africa, the prevalence of refractive error and visual impairment due to refractive error was 12.6% and 3.4%, respectively. In Ethiopia, the prevalence of visual impairment due to refractive error varies from 2.5% in the Gurage zone to 12.3% in Hawassa city. Hence, this Meta-analysis aimed to summarize the pooled prevalence of visual impairment due to refractive error in Ethiopia.

METHODS

A systematic search of the literature was conducted by the authors to identify all relevant primary studies. All articles on the prevalence of visual impairment due to refractive error in Ethiopia were identified through a literature search. The databases used to search for studies were PubMed, Science Direct, POPLINE, HENARI, Google Scholar, and grey literature was searched on Google until December 15, 2021. In this meta-analysis, the presence of publication bias was evaluated using funnel plots and Begg's tests at a significance level of less than 0.05. The sensitivity analysis was conducted to check for a single study's effect on the overall prevalence of refractive error.

RESULT

About 1664 studies were retrieved from initial electronic searches using international databases and google searches. A total number of 20,088 children and adolescents were included in this meta-analysis. The pooled prevalence of visual impairment due to refractive error in Ethiopia using the random effects model was estimated to be 6% (95% CI, 5-7) with a significant level of heterogeneity (I2 = 94.4%; p < 0.001). The pooled prevalence of visual impairment due to refractive was analyzed by subtypes, and pooled prevalence was estimated to be 4%, 5.2%, and 1% for myopia, hyperopia, and astigmatism, respectively.

CONCLUSION

The pooled prevalence of visual impairment due to refractive error was high in Ethiopia. About one in twenty-five Ethiopian children and adolescents are affected by visual impairment due to myopia.

摘要

简介

全球屈光不正的患病率为 12%,屈光不正导致的视力损害为 2.1%。在撒哈拉以南非洲,屈光不正的患病率和屈光不正导致的视力损害分别为 12.6%和 3.4%。在埃塞俄比亚,屈光不正导致的视力损害的患病率从古尔加地区的 2.5%到哈瓦萨市的 12.3%不等。因此,本荟萃分析旨在总结埃塞俄比亚屈光不正导致的视力损害的患病率。

方法

作者进行了系统的文献检索,以确定所有相关的原始研究。通过文献检索确定了所有关于埃塞俄比亚屈光不正导致的视力损害患病率的文章。用于搜索研究的数据库包括 PubMed、Science Direct、POPLINE、HENARI、Google Scholar 和 Google 上的灰色文献,搜索时间截至 2021 年 12 月 15 日。在这项荟萃分析中,使用漏斗图和 Begg 检验评估了发表偏倚的存在,显著性水平设为小于 0.05。进行敏感性分析以检查单个研究对屈光不正总体患病率的影响。

结果

从国际数据库和谷歌搜索的初步电子搜索中检索到约 1664 项研究。共有 20088 名儿童和青少年纳入本荟萃分析。使用随机效应模型估计,埃塞俄比亚屈光不正导致的视力损害的总患病率为 6%(95%CI,5-7),具有显著的异质性(I2=94.4%;p<0.001)。根据亚型分析屈光不正导致的视力损害的患病率,近视、远视和散光的患病率分别估计为 4%、5.2%和 1%。

结论

埃塞俄比亚屈光不正导致的视力损害的患病率较高。大约每 25 名埃塞俄比亚儿童和青少年中就有 1 人受到近视导致的视力损害的影响。
